Engineering Leadership Through Multi-Agent Simulations

The transition from a senior technical contributor to an effective leader is often the most jarring pivot in an engineer's career. While we have CI/CD pipelines to test our code, how do we reliably "test" our empathy, conflict resolution, and strategic team-building skills before deploying them in production with real humans?
In this session, we will explore the architecture and psychology behind a custom-built AI application designed to simulate high-stakes leadership challenges. Rather than relying on static multiple-choice tests, this platform utilizes advanced AI agent orchestration to create dynamic, interactive scenarios. Attendees will see firsthand how the application places users in complex team-building dilemmas, forcing them to make difficult management decisions in real-time.
More importantly, we will lift the hood on the "Critical Auditor" component. You will learn how the system evaluates human input, cross-references decisions against established business and leadership frameworks, and generates personalized, critical insights for improvement.
Whether you are an engineering manager looking to sharpen your edge, or an architect interested in novel use cases for AI orchestration, this talk will provide a blueprint for blending advanced technology with human-centric leadership.


Soft skills are notoriously hard to measure. Discover how a custom AI application powered by multi-agent orchestration simulates complex team challenges, critically audits your decision-making, and provides actionable insights to forge better engineering leaders.
